Tips to handle one year walking baby



One year old baby try walk. Help him to walk. At this age a baby's nature tells him to be leery and suspicious of strangers till he had a chance to look them over. Then he wants to get closer and eventually make friends in a 1 year old fashion. When your baby is old enough to walk, give him plenty of chances to get used to strangers and make up to them. Take him to the nearby shopping complex a couple of time a week. If possible, take him everyday where other small children play. He isn't able to play with them yet, but at times he wants to watch. If he is used to playing near them now, he will be ready for co-operative play when the time comes between 2 and 3. If he's never been around other children by 3, it will take him months just to get used to them.
